#7c7084 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7c7084 is composed of 48.6% red, 43.9%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.1% cyan, 15.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 276 degrees, a saturation of 8.2% and a lightness of 47.8%. #7c7084 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8e0ff with #000009.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#7c7084 color description : Dark grayish violet.
#7c7084 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7c7084 has RGB values of R:124, G:112,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 8155268.
